At its core, polynomial subtraction involves subtracting one polynomial from another. A polynomial is an expression consisting of variables and coefficients, with each term having a degree or exponent. The process of subtracting polynomials is similar to combining like terms, where the coefficients and variables are aligned and subtracted. To subtract a polynomial, you need to:
